🦠 What Is SIBO, and Why Is It So Misunderstood?
SIBO happens when bacteria that normally live in the large intestine end up multiplying in the small intestine, where they don’t belong. These misplaced bacteria feed on your food especially carbohydrates, too early in the digestive process. This creates gas, bloating, and other uncomfortable symptoms.
What makes SIBO so tricky is that it mimics other common gut issues. A study published in the American Journal of Gastroenterology found that up to 78% of people diagnosed with IBS (Irritable Bowel Syndrome) actually had SIBO when tested using a lactulose breath test1.
That means many people are treating the wrong problem, just managing symptoms, not fixing the root cause.

🧬 How Does SIBO Start?
SIBO can sneak up for many reasons:
-
Low stomach acid (due to aging, medications, or stress)
-
Frequent antibiotic use, which wipes out beneficial gut bacteria
-
Slow gut motility (often seen in people with hypothyroidism or diabetes)
-
Abdominal surgeries or injuries
-
Chronic stress, which weakens your digestive and immune systems
Once the small intestine becomes a breeding ground for misplaced bacteria, digestion suffers and so does your quality of life.

🍽️ Everyday Habits to Boost Your Gut Health
Support your SIBO healing journey by combining PrebioShotz with simple lifestyle tweaks:
-
Wait 3–4 hours between meals – This gives your digestive system time to cleanse itself.
-
Chew your food thoroughly – Digestion begins in your mouth!
-
Avoid excessive sugar and ultra-processed foods – They feed the wrong bacteria.
-
Take a walk after meals – Boosts motility and reduces gas buildup.
-
Stay hydrated – Water supports nutrient transport and digestive flow.
🧘♀️ Don’t Underestimate Stress
Your gut and brain are connected. Chronic stress slows digestion and messes with gut function, making symptoms worse. Just 10 minutes of deep breathing or a short walk can lower your stress levels and help your gut recover.
